    Israel to send team for Gaza ceasefire talks in Qatar | Israel-Palestine conflict News

    Israel is anticipated to ship a delegation to Doha to barter truce extension deal on Monday after Hamas held talks with Egyptian officers in Cairo.

    Israel has confirmed it would ship a delegation to Qatar’s capital for talks on extending a fragile ceasefire with Hamas.

    On Saturday evening,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u stated a delegation could be despatched to Doha on Monday in “an effort to advance negotiations”.

    This comes after a Hamas workforce met Egyptian officers in Cairo on Saturday to barter the second part of the ceasefire deal.

    “The delegation emphasised the need of adhering to all phrases of the settlement continuing instantly to provoke negotiations for the second part, opening the border crossings, and permitting the entry of aid supplies into Gaza with none restrictions or situations,” it stated in a press release.

    In earlier feedback, Hamas spokesperson Abdel Latif al-Qanoua stated a day earlier that “indicators are optimistic concerning the beginning of negotiations for the second part”.

    The primary part of the ceasefire deal ended on March 1 , after six weeks of exchanges, together with 25 residing Israeli captives held in Gaza for the discharge of 1,800 Palestinians in Israeli prisons.

    Israel has stated it needs to increase the primary stage of the settlement till mid-April, refusing to maneuver to the second stage of the deal that includes an entire finish to the struggle and full withdrawal of its forces from Gaza.

    Hamas, nevertheless, says it needs either side to maneuver to the second part as agreed.

    Protests in Tel Aviv

    In the meantime, freed Israeli captives and households of these nonetheless held in Gaza known as on the federal government to maneuver on to the second stage of the deal and stop a return to struggle.

    Throughout a protest in Tel Aviv on Saturday night, Einav Zangauker, mom of Matan Zangauker, who’s being held in Gaza, accused Netanyahu of taking part in a “political recreation of chess” with the captives.

    Relations and associates of Israelis held in Gaza elevate placards as they rally to demand motion for his or her launch, in entrance of the Israeli defence ministry in Tel Aviv [File: Jack Guez/AFP]

    “The struggle may resume in every week … Solely an settlement that brings them suddenly will guarantee their return,” she stated.

    Reporting from Jordan, Al Jazeera’s Hamdah Salhut stated Israel’s push to see an extension of part one of many deal has led to a blockade of desperately wanted humanitarian help.

    “There’s nonetheless a lot strain on Netanyahu from members of the family of captives who’re accusing the premier of prolonging the struggle for his personal private and political achieve,” she stated.

    Amid the talks, Israel continued its lethal assault on Gaza, killing not less than three Palestinians on Saturday.

    Palestinians in Gaza are additionally struggling underneath the help blockade, which has worsened a dire humanitarian disaster amid the Muslim holy month of Ramadan.

    Since Friday evening, Rafah has been the goal of intense Israeli assaults from tanks and drones, with shelling affecting residential areas, together with al-Jnaina, ash-Shawka and Tal as-Sultan, the Palestinian information company Wafa reported.

    In keeping with Gaza’s Ministry of Well being, not less than 48,453 Palestinians have been killed and 111,860 wounded by Israeli assaults since October 7, 2023.
